Measles #5
In "The Fake Santa Claus," Joost Swarte’s distinctive art and storytelling shine as Hector, ever the caretaker, ensures a stray cat hit by a car gets proper care at the kitty hospital. When Zachary offers a gas cap to the ambulance driver—unaware it was meant for Dexter’s garage-bound car—the small act sets off a quiet chain of miscommunications and unintended consequences. With writing and art by Joost Swarte, and a delightfully layered cover by Rick Altergott, Jaime Hernandez, Joost Swarte, Steven Weissman, and Gilbert Hernandez, this 2000 Fantagraphics issue blends whimsy and wry observation in a story that’s as precise as it is poignant.

A hit and run driver runs over a kitty so Hector makes sure the ambulance takes her to the kitty hospital. Zachary gives the ambulance driver a gas cap that he needed, but Dexter needed the cap for a car that's in the garage.
